GasX
Malaysia's Over-the-Counter (OTC) marketplace for domestic natural gas trading that enables bids, offers, spot and forward transactions, and price transparency across the Peninsular Gas Utilisation (PGU) network. GasX serves shippers, traders, brokers, and domestic end consumers through a secure, subscription-based digital platform.

LNGX
An independent, transparent, and secure digital platform supporting the importation of LNG into Malaysia. LNGX facilitates structured transactions between LNG suppliers and importers, supporting Malaysia's gas supply diversification as liberalisation progresses.
